What is Triple Glazing?
Triple glazing refers to windows that are made up of 3 panes of glass with area in between them, typically filled with gases such as argon or krypton. This design helps to significantly lower heat loss and sound transmission, making buildings more energy-efficient and quieter.

Buying triple glazing features a multitude of advantages:

Improved Energy Efficiency: The most considerable advantage of triple Residential Glazing Services is its ability to decrease heat loss. Homeowners can expect lower energy expenses due to enhanced insulation.

Decreased Noise Pollution: The extra layer of glass and gas insulation significantly dampens outside noise, producing a more serene indoor environment.

Improved Security: The 3 panes offer an added layer of defense against burglaries, making homes safer.

UV Protection: Triple Glazing Warranty-glazed windows can help block damaging ultraviolet rays, protecting furnishings and flooring from fading.

Sustainability: The increased energy efficiency adds to a decreased carbon footprint, lining up with international sustainability goals.

Is triple glazing worth the financial investment?
Absolutely! While the in advance cost is greater than double glazing, the long-term savings on energy expenses, along with increased home value, usually make it a worthwhile investment.
2. Just how much can I conserve on my energy costs with triple glazing?
Homeowners usually see a 10-25% reduction in their heating bills after setting up triple glazing, however this can vary based upon elements such as environment, home insulation, and energy usage patterns.
3. Does triple glazing offer a lot more insulation than double glazing?
Yes, triple glazing considerably enhances insulation capabilities by providing an extra layer of glass and gas fill, reducing heat loss and noise penetration even more compared to double glazing.
4. Can I set up triple glazing myself?
While DIY installation is appealing, it is highly suggested to work with professionals. Proper installation is critical for accomplishing optimum energy effectiveness and security.
5. How do I keep my triple-glazed windows?
Maintenance is comparable to other window types. Routine cleansing with non-abrasive solutions is recommended, and any fogging in between glass panes may need professional attention.
